The Life and Legacy of Frank Fritz: A Look at His Final Days
Frank Fritz, the beloved star of the popular reality series American Pickers, passed away on September 30, 2023, at the age of 60. His death, which has left fans and friends mourning, was officially attributed to complications from a stroke, as detailed in his death certificate obtained by various media outlets, including TMZ. The revelation of his cause of death has prompted a deeper reflection on his life, career, and the impact he had on those around him.
The Medical Background
Fritz’s death was classified as a “late sequela of cerebral infarction,” indicating that he suffered a stroke. According to medical professionals, this condition is often linked to cerebral vascular disease, which disrupts blood flow and affects the brain’s blood vessels. The American Association of Neurological Surgeons describes this disease as a significant health concern that can lead to severe complications, including strokes.
In addition to his stroke, Fritz had been battling other serious health issues. He suffered from aortic stenosis, a condition characterized by the narrowing of the heart’s main valve, which can severely restrict blood flow. He also had ch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), a progressive lung disease that makes it difficult to breathe. These health challenges undoubtedly contributed to the struggles he faced in his later years.

The Journey of American Pickers
American Pickers debuted in 2010, showcasing Fritz and Wolfe as they traveled across the United States in search of hidden treasures and antiques. Their chemistry and shared passion for history and discovery captivated audiences, making the show a staple of reality television. However, Fritz’s last appearance on the series was in March 2020, after which he faced health challenges that led to a temporary departure from the show.
Despite the strain in their relationship during his absence, Wolfe and Fritz eventually reconciled. Wolfe had publicly shared updates about Fritz’s health, including the news of his stroke in 2022, demonstrating the enduring bond between the two men.
